Zacharia Olivier, Rudolf de Wet and William Musora appeared in court facing charges of murder, attempted murder, and possession of unlicensed firearms and ammunition. The remains of Maria Makgato and Kudzai Ndlovu were found decomposed in a pigsty on a farm in Onverwacht outside Polokwane last month.

The men are accused of gunning down Maria Makgato and Kudzai Ndlovu whose decomposed remains were found in a pigsty on a farm in Onverwacht outside Polokwane last month.The accused – Zacharia Olivier, Rudolf de Wet and William Musora – are facing charges of murder, attempted murder and possession of unlicenced firearms and ammunition.The chairperson of the Economic Freedom Fighters in the Capricorn Region, Molatelo Mahladisa says they want justice to be served.

“As the Economic Freedom Fighters, we are here to oppose bail for these murders. We will also come and give support to the families and communities that these perpetrators must rot in jail. They must not be given bail.
